Bill Rivers BP
Bill Rivers is the senior writer at BP America, delivering strategic communications messages for executive leaders on energy issues within the US and worldwide. Bill
served as speechwriter for U.S. Secretary of Defense Jim Mattis at the Pentagon from 2017-19, traveling extensively and developing strategic messages in support of U.S. national security priorities.
Prior to the Pentagon, Bill held communications roles in the U.S. Senate, including deputy press secretary for Senator Pat Toomey. Bill holds an MPA from the University of Pennsylvania, where he studied as a Truman Scholar, and a BA in International Relations from the University of Delaware. He is an NBC News contributor. Bill and his wife and son live in Virginia.
